On Monday, K-pop sensation Billlie made waves with a vibrant poster, offering a glimpse into their highly anticipated return to the music scene. The artwork showcased the members walking hand in hand, and it notably revealed the release dates for their upcoming singles, "BYOB (bring your own best friend)" and "Dang! (hocus pocus)."
"BYOB (bring your own best friend)," the group's inaugural English-language track, is set to debut this Wednesday, as indicated by the poster. Excitement surged among fans with a preview of the song, shared in a short-form video on TikTok over the weekend, garnering an impressive 1.9 million views by Monday and providing a tantalizing taste of the catchy melody.
In the near future, Billlie plans to unveil a new album, although this time with a slightly altered lineup. The upcoming release will feature five members, as Moon Sua and Suhyeon have taken a temporary hiatus from group activities since earlier this month and mid-June, respectively. Despite the changes, anticipation remains high for their musical endeavors, as they continue to evolve and redefine their sonic identity.
